    Factors Associated with the Incidence of Breast Cancer in RSUD Dr. Pirngadi Medan in 2024

    Abstract
    Breast cancer is one of the cancers with the highest number of new cases in Southeast Asia and the most prevalent in Indonesian women. Factors that influence the incidence of breast cancer are so diverse and potential for someone to have one of these risk factors. Epidemiologic studies showed that risk factors are divided into non-modifiable factors including genetic factors, family history, age, and gender. Modifiable risk factors include lifestyle and environment, such as a high-fat and low-fiber diet, lack of physical activity and radiation exposure. In addition, hormonal factors such as age at first menstruation, age at menopause, and use of hormonal contraceptives also play a role in breast cancer risk. The purpose of this study was to determine the factors associated with the incidence of breast cancer at RSUD Dr. Pirngadi Medan in 2024. This type of research uses quantitative research with a case control. Sampling technique used purposive sampling method with a total of 50 respondents consisting of 25 cases and 25 controls. The results of this study indicate that there is no associated between age at diagnosis, family history, age at first menstruation (menarche), age at first childbirth, menopausal age, and obesity with breast cancer incidence at RSUD Dr. Pirngadi Medan in 2024. Then there is a association between breastfeeding history with p value = 0,002 and OR = 6,729 as well as use of hormonal contraceptives with p value = 0,009 and OR = 5,091 with the incidence of breast cancer at RSUD Dr. Pirngadi Medan in 2024. This study is expected to be able to explore more deeply about breast cancer risk factors with the same or different variables and methods so that progress can be seen in the discovery of associated risk factors
